Output e5940eeadebd52e89d0c90d4a4cbedf135fec6af187b2efed078f6a270863181:3

value
23910000
script pubkey
OP_0 OP_PUSHBYTES_20 cdc4c339d0eb397c48b1b10fce27eacc7c56c305
address
ltc1qehzvxwwsavuhcj93ky8uufl2e379dsc9jjxhgw
transaction
e5940eeadebd52e89d0c90d4a4cbedf135fec6af187b2efed078f6a270863181
spent
true